The Best Vermicompost System in the World? - Worm Composting Made Easy!

Learning and share your experiences.
Post Reply
demola
Posts: 186
Joined: Thu Dec 12, 2019 7:37 pm

The Best Vermicompost System in the World? - Worm Composting Made Easy!

Post by demola »

Post Reply